Solution

The correct option is A q22ε0Ak
As we know that the electric force between the plates of capacitor is given by F=qE.

The electric field due to one plate is given by (if dielectric medium is present), E=σ2ε0k

Therefore, force between the plates is
F=q(σ2ε0k)

As we know that σ=qA

Therefore, force F=q(qA2ε0k)=q22Aε0k
